    Anyway....find someplace with a lot of Daedra or Undead, with the ability to pull 5+ mobs at a time without running too far. Make sure your build isnt healer or tank, if you want to level fast, but AoE dps (easy to do, all classes can build such). Try to get fighters guild skill up high enough to allow you to get Banish the Wicked passive (this is why we pull daedra and undead). If you cannot get BtW passive (and if you did all your alliance you should be able to EASILY), anywhere allowing you to pull multiple ogres or minotaurs works too. Mass pull, using AoE dps ultimates every chance you get.

    Have you not seen people asking for skyreach carries in zone chat, and paying 3.5K per run (The 3.5K was the most recent offer I'd seen, I've seen more. For guildies, I'd do it for free)

    Other places include:

    alik'r beach zombie grind
    cold harbor zombie grind
    alik'r tri-dolmen grind


    There's other too (I won't mention anymore as some people like to keep their spots away from the spotlight) but Skyreach still seem's to be no.1

    Having said that, questing now nets a fair whack too, you aren't penalized anywhere near as much as you used to be for XP compared to the bordeom and repetition of a grind spot.

    Skyreach if you can solo, or if you can find someone to carry.

    There are good overland spots too (not nearly as good as Skyreach, but easily soloable at any level), but nobody will tell you where they are because they aren't instanced and will get flooded with people.

    I will give you a hint though. Look for a spot that has a lot of weak, fast-spawning enemies (zombies, dreughs, ogres, etc.).

    In peak hours I usually go for a public dungeon with very few people. I have a pretty safe spot in one public dungeon where no-one ever goes unless they are just passing through for quest. Enemies are tightly packed, but I'd rather not share. :tongue:

    Off peak hours, I always pick a place where raw materials drop frequently, Good chance to get Yellow upgrades when refining materials. Preferably clothing, so you get a nice stash of Dreugh Wax eventually to upgrade your gear, if you're medium or light armor.

    If you're Heavy armor, or need weapon upgrades don't go to dungeons, just roam areas where there is lots of Blacksmithing nodes, and kill anything around. A bit slower, but will save you a ton of money upgrading your gear later. I usually just roam wrothgar, near cliffs and mountains, but there's probably other good spots.

    All in all I try to pick places where i get both XP and crafting materials to refine if possible.
